In an exciting match at the 2024 Olympic Games held at the renowned Roland-Garros Stadium, Diane Parry of France faced off against Nadia Podoroska representing Argentina in the Women's Singles First Round. The match took place on July 28, 2024, on Court 12, where both players showcased remarkable skill and determination. The match lasted for 2 hours and 17 minutes and concluded with a victorious score of 7-6(6), 7-5 in favor of Parry.

The first set was particularly intense, featuring a tie-break that saw both players delivering strong serves and strategic plays. Parry managed to clinch the first set with a narrow tie-break victory, showcasing her composure under pressure. In the second set, Podoroska fought hard but ultimately fell short, allowing Parry to secure her spot in the next round.

Statistically, Parry won a total of 91 points during the match, with 35 points coming from her first serve and 13 from her second serve, maintaining a solid winning percentage on both serves. She demonstrated her prowess at the net with a total of 14 net points won. On the other hand, Podoroska had a commendable performance as well, winning a total of 83 points, but faced challenges with 37 unforced errors that hindered her chances of victory.

With this win, Diane Parry advances in the tournament, while Nadia Podoroska, despite her efforts, will exit the competition. This match is a testament to the high level of tennis played at the Olympic Games, with both athletes showcasing their talent and competitive spirit.
